Smyth Companies LLC is expanding at its Bedford County, Virginia facility. The label company has announced it is investing more than $4.6 million in new sheetfed offset printing equipment, which will be installed in the coming months.
The move is expected to add a minimum of 16 full-time jobs over the next three years.
Bedford was selected for the expansion because it is the company’s biggest facility. “The corporate office decided to put the press in Bedford, Virginia because the employee base we have here. We have great employees that do a great job with new technology so what better place to put it than Bedford, Virginia?” said Ryan Allison, vice president of operations for Smyth.
The Bedford County Economic Development Authority will help the company under a $25,000 grant as part of a performance agreement. The investment will give the company a greater capacity to grow its production and improve efficiencies.
